I Have Been Having Upper Arm(both Arms) Aching Pain After

I have been having upper arm(both arms) aching pain after certain movements with my arms raised or reaching behind me. It is getting progressively worse. There is no pain at rest, and I can sleep with no problems as long as I keep my arms lowered. It is not excercise related as I can work out and do cardio with no problems. I am 61 years old and in very good health, take no meds and have good blood pressure, etc. It started about 10 months ago. The ache lasts for 10 to 20 seconds after moving my arm(s) to certain positions, then goes away.
